Joining forces as one team

Tabor Community Services and Lancaster Housing Opportunity Partnership (LHOP) teams worked side-by-side to leverage our collective resources and expertise to navigate the significant events that were unfolding in our country. Our merger was finalized in January 2021, and our new identity – Tenfold – was rolled out in April 2021. Our programs, services, and brand are reflective of the principles upon which we were founded, while capturing the energy of our new direction toward a community where homelessness is rare, where housing affordability is the norm, and where homeownership is a key to unlocking generational wealth.

Developing creative solutions in the midst of the COVID-19 pandemic

We continue to navigate the COVID-19 pandemic, balancing the safety of our clients and team members, while continuing to offer vital services and solutions to our clients and community at a time of economic hardship. That meant fast-tracking technology solutions like virtual financial education and housing case management, deepening partnerships through the Eviction Prevention Network, and expanding TLC’s emergency shelter services to include singles (in addition to families), among other enhancements.
